PostForum: Land Rover   Posted: Thu Mar 16, 2017 5:23 pm   Subject: 1998 300Tdi Disco starting issue
Check the earth strap from the starter motor. A dodgy earth strap might allow the minimal current from the solenoid but not the large current needed by the starter motor.

PostForum: Land Rover   Posted: Tue Dec 13, 2016 7:49 am   Subject: Td5 defender
White smoke which smells of diesel usually means too much air/not enough diesel.

White smoke which does not smell of diesel or smells sweet and cloying is usually coolant leaking into cylinders. It ...
